Specifications
Top Termination: Screws
Material Flammability Rating: UL94 V-0
Material - Insulation: Polyamide (PA), Nylon
Operating Temperature: -60°C ~ 105°C
Mounting Type: Through Hole
Terminal Screw Finish: Zinc, Clear Chromate
Terminal Screw Material: Steel
Color: Black
Features: --
Barrier Type: 2 Wall (Dual)
Bottom Termination: Wire Wrap
Series: SSB7, Buchanan
Wire Gauge: 12-22 AWG
Voltage Rating: 600V
Current Rating: 20A
Number of Rows: 1
Pitch: 0.438" (11.12mm)
Number of Wire Entries: 22
Number of Circuits: 22
Terminal Block Type: Barrier Block
Part Status: Obsolete
Packaging: Bulk
